Bomboloni Fritti

 




Bomboloni Fritti

Prep 20 min + rising / Cook 10 min / Serves 10


Ingredients

300 g allpurpose flour

40 g sugar

6 g instant yeast

1 large egg

120 g whole milk (lukewarm)

40 g unsalted butter (soft)

1 g fine salt

1 L oil for frying

100 g caster sugar (for coating)

300 g pastry cream or Nutella (for filling)


Instructions


  • Make the dough: In a bowl, mix flour, sugar, yeast, and salt. Add the egg and warm milk. Mix until a rough dough forms, then add the soft butter and knead until smooth (8–10 minutes).
  • First rise: Cover the dough and let it rise for 1–1.5 hours, until doubled.
  • Shape: Roll the dough to 1.5 cm thickness. Cut circles (6–7 cm). Place them on parchment and cover lightly.
  • Second rise: Let the bomboloni rise again for 30–40 minutes until puffy.
  • Fry: Heat oil to 165–170°C. Fry 2–3 at a time, turning often, until golden (about 2 minutes per side).
  • Coat: Drain briefly, then roll in caster sugar while warm.
  • Fill: Once slightly cooled, poke a hole and pipe in pastry cream or Nutella.


Beginner Tips 

  • Warm milk, not hot: If the milk is too hot, it kills the yeast. Aim for body temperature.
  • Soft butter is key: Cold butter makes the dough heavy; roomtemperature butter blends smoothly.
  • Don’t rush the rise: A slow, full rise gives you fluffy bomboloni.
  • Oil temperature matters: Too hot dark outside, raw inside. Too cold greasy. Stay around 165–170°C.
  • Fill when warm, not hot: Hot bomboloni melt the filling; cold ones resist piping.
